The 49ers Will Trade Alex Smith

While The Demand for QB is High The San Francisco 49ers will attempt to trade
 quarterback Alex Smith this off-season


The Former No. 1 overall draft pick, lost his starting job to Colin Kaepernick while sitting out with a concussion but has been professional at every turn and has continued to mentor his replacement. If San Francisco deals Smith instead of cutting him, it would save the $1 million or $2 million roster bonus it would have to pay if he is released.

The Eagles, Browns, And Chiefs all have expressed interest, and may be in need of Smith’s services.
